Abstract
The following notes deal with a collection of sandflies from Africa sent for identification by Sir Guy Marshall, C.M.G., F.R.S., of the Imperial Institute of Entomology, by Dr. Pontes from Mozambique, by Major W. F. M. Loughnan, R.A.M.C., Mauritius, and with a number of specimens lent to Prof. Adler by the London School of Tropical Medicine. I am indebted to Prof. Adler for placing this material at my disposal.Keywords
